Output e6988136cff76847ba753112a797eed81b89b4d65e2117a6c9d19a297419bf74:25

value
106689904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ef450a98deca7971a1d9a9dc95638accf36fb43a OP_EQUAL
address
3PWA8UJEDkTzXafDBFM6DyS2hRFWyPVywG
transaction
e6988136cff76847ba753112a797eed81b89b4d65e2117a6c9d19a297419bf74
spent
true